WebThe tasseled scorpionfish, or Small-scaled scorpionfish, Scorpaenopsis oxycephala, is a carnivorous ray-finned fish with venomous spines that lives in the Indian and Pacific Oceans. It can reach a maximum length of 36 cm and can vary considerably in color. Adults are bearded with a number of tassels below the jaw. Web27 Jan 2024 · Scorpion fish habitat. Most scorpionfish live in the ocean, but a few species live in freshwater. They are widespread in tropical and temperate seas but mostly found in the Indo-Pacific. Scorpionfish typically live alone and only come together during the mating season. During the day, scorpionfish hide in caves, holes, or coral reefs; some can ...

Web12 Nov 2024 · The scorpionfish is one of the most venomous fish in the world. It has several spines linked to venom glands. The poison causes severe pain and paralysis. The scorpionfish is extermely well-camouflaged. It can change colour to match its background and has many "tassles" masking its outline.
Web3 Aug 2024 · In the south west of England, the long spined sea scorpion is a fairly common fish. You will find it in rockpools, gulleys, harbours and on beaches. I have found them to be prevalent where there is decent cover like seaweed, large rocks and sea walls.
